When it comes to oral health, what you eat matters. A diet rich in vitamins, minerals, and other nutrients helps keep teeth and gums healthy and prevents tooth decay and gum disease. Learn about the top ten foods that provide significant benefits for oral health.


Oats are packed with nutrients that have been shown to promote oral health, including fiber, magnesium, and phosphorus. Oats also help lower blood sugar levels and are a good source of magnesium, which helps promote strong teeth and bones. The high phosphorus content of oats can help remineralize tooth enamel and prevent tooth decay.


Studies have shown that mint helps kill bacteria in the mouth, leading to fresher breath and a reduced risk of cavities. Mint is often used as an ingredient in toothpaste and mouthwash because it fights gum disease and bad breath.


Yogurt is high in calcium, which is essential for strong teeth. Live cultures in yogurt support your mouth’s microbiome by fighting off harmful bacteria like Streptococcus mutans, which can cause cavities and gum disease. It also neutralizes acidic foods that can damage tooth enamel.


Eating an apple increases saliva production, which washes away food particles and bacteria. Apples are also a good source of fluoride, which strengthens tooth enamel and prevents cavities. The crisp texture of apples also helps remove plaque and bacterial build-up on the surface of teeth.


Nuts contain nutrients that protect against gum disease and tooth decay. For example, walnuts are a good source of vitamin E, which reduces inflammation in the gums; almonds contain fluoride, which prevents tooth decay; and pistachios contain lutein, which protects against gum disease.


Kiwis are an excellent source of vitamin C. This vitamin is essential for producing collagen to keep gums and periodontal ligaments healthy. It also protects teeth from damage by strengthening the enamel and supports wound healing and immunity. Kiwis also contain various other minerals and vitamins necessary for oral health, including potassium, magnesium, and folate.


Broccoli is an excellent source of vitamin C, essential for maintaining healthy gums. Vitamin C repairs and prevents damage to the connective tissues that support the teeth, and it also boosts the immune system, which can help to fight off bacterial infections. Broccoli also contains a compound called sulforaphane, which has been shown to kill bacteria that cause cavities and gum diseases like Porphyromonas gingivalis.


This crunchy vegetable stimulates saliva production, which can help keep the mouth clean and free of bacteria. In addition, this fibrous vegetable removes plaque and food debris from teeth.


Onions contain nutrients like vitamin C, B6, folic acid, and potassium. Folic acid is crucial for red blood cell health. Without it, your gum tissue won’t receive enough oxygen and may become discolored and prone to damage. Potassium is critical for enamel remineralization and jawbone health, while vitamin B6 can reduce inflammation.

Onions also contain sulfur compounds, crucial components in forming proteins required for building teeth and gum tissue.


Although dentists recommend against consuming too much dried fruit, raisins contain phytochemicals that help prevent cavities and reduce inflammation in the gums. They are also a good source of calcium, which is essential for keeping teeth strong.

Your diet is an integral part of maintaining your oral health. However, even a balanced diet cannot prevent cavities and gum disease without proper oral hygiene and professional dental care.

